
Rhino Entertainment Group adds more ex-Hero Gaming talent to top team
Andrea Saliba reunited with David Borg and Marie Theobald following brief stint at Kindred Group


Rhino Entertainment Group has continued its hiring spree of ex-Hero Gaming talent after securing Andrea Saliba as its new global head of people and culture.
Saliba joins Rhino Entertainment after a brief stint as a HR business partner at Kindred Group.
He previously spent more than four years at Hero Gaming in the operator’s HR division.
Saliba joined the business in May 2018 as an HR business partner before being named people and culture manager in April 2020.
He was further promoted to head of people and culture in September 2021 and was appointed director of people and culture in August 2022.
Saliba is set to link up with former Hero Gaming colleagues David Borg and Marie Theobald at Rhino Entertainment.
Borg now serves as the group’s chief operating officer while Theoblad was named as chief people officer in September 2022.

Hero Gaming underwent a streamlining process in November, which saw former CEO Patrick Jonker depart after just 10 months in the role.
Along with Jonker’s departure, the process saw around half of the group’s workforce leave, including C-level and senior staff.
